The turborunner is on hold for now but i did a little upgrade on the '84... i've been wanting to do this for a while, so when my buddy's head broke off my rearview mirror while wheeling i decided it was time.
2nd gen mirror/maplight updgrade:
had some material layin around so i made the spacer from 1/4" pvc - i know most guys use 1/2" so we'll see if i can get enough play out of the headliner for this to work, or if i need to go another route.

got the mirror all cleaned up and installed. ran the wires over to the drivers side pillar and tapped into the dome light circuit, pretty simple for wiring. turned out well but now that i see it in daylight i think they gave me a blue mirror instead of gray, so i might have to paint it
